Back in 1864, the area around Loose Park was a large farm owned by William Bent. Bent’s land extended east to Wornall Lane. On the other side of the lane was the farm owned by John B. Wornall. Bent acquired the property in 1856.

Born in St. Louis in 1809, William Bent went west to Colorado with his brother, Charles, when he was 17 years old. Bent spent his years out west trapping, trading and hauling some freight along the Santa Fe Trail. Bent periodically returned to Missouri, which may have motivated his acquisition of the farm along Wornall Lane.

There is conflicting evidence to determine whether the current Bent House located near Sunset Drive and 55th Street existed in 1864. There is evidence that the northern section of the mansion is antebellum, probably constructed in the 1850s. After Bent’s death in 1869, Seth E. Ward purchased Bent’s Farm from the Bent estate. It may have been Ward who added that part of the house that you can see from 55th Street.
